Writing about evidence-based practice requires a structured approach to effectively communicate your ideas and findings. Begin by clearly defining your research question or topic related to evidence-based practice in nursing. Conduct a thorough literature review to gather relevant evidence and critically evaluate the quality of the studies you find. When presenting your findings, use a logical and organized format that includes an introduction, background information, methodology, results, discussion, and conclusion. It's also crucial to cite your sources accurately and adhere to the guidelines for academic writing in nursing.
